Searched refs:uhci_hcd (Results 1 – 11 of 11) sorted by relevance
/linux-6.3-rc2/drivers/usb/host/ |
A D | uhci-hcd.h | 383 struct uhci_hcd { struct 450 void (*reset_hc) (struct uhci_hcd *uhci); argument 451 int (*check_and_reset_hc) (struct uhci_hcd *uhci); argument 453 void (*configure_hc) (struct uhci_hcd *uhci); argument 457 int (*global_suspend_mode_is_broken) (struct uhci_hcd *uhci); argument 461 static inline struct uhci_hcd *hcd_to_uhci(struct usb_hcd *hcd) in hcd_to_uhci() 463 return (struct uhci_hcd *) (hcd->hcd_priv); in hcd_to_uhci() 465 static inline struct usb_hcd *uhci_to_hcd(struct uhci_hcd *uhci) in uhci_to_hcd() 497 static inline bool uhci_is_aspeed(const struct uhci_hcd *uhci) in uhci_is_aspeed() 530 static inline u8 uhci_readb(const struct uhci_hcd *uhci, int reg) in uhci_readb() [all …]
|
A D | uhci-hcd.c | 93 static void wakeup_rh(struct uhci_hcd *uhci); 388 static void start_rh(struct uhci_hcd *uhci) in start_rh() 410 static void wakeup_rh(struct uhci_hcd *uhci) in wakeup_rh() 452 struct uhci_hcd *uhci = hcd_to_uhci(hcd); in uhci_irq() 578 struct uhci_hcd *uhci = hcd_to_uhci(hcd); in uhci_start() 710 struct uhci_hcd *uhci = hcd_to_uhci(hcd); in uhci_stop() 726 struct uhci_hcd *uhci = hcd_to_uhci(hcd); in uhci_rh_suspend() 753 struct uhci_hcd *uhci = hcd_to_uhci(hcd); in uhci_rh_resume() 771 struct uhci_hcd *uhci = hcd_to_uhci(hcd); in uhci_hcd_endpoint_disable() 795 struct uhci_hcd *uhci = hcd_to_uhci(hcd); in uhci_hcd_get_frame_number() [all …]
|
A D | uhci-pci.c | 27 static void uhci_pci_reset_hc(struct uhci_hcd *uhci) in uhci_pci_reset_hc() 38 static int uhci_pci_check_and_reset_hc(struct uhci_hcd *uhci) in uhci_pci_check_and_reset_hc() 48 static void uhci_pci_configure_hc(struct uhci_hcd *uhci) in uhci_pci_configure_hc() 60 static int uhci_pci_resume_detect_interrupts_are_broken(struct uhci_hcd *uhci) in uhci_pci_resume_detect_interrupts_are_broken() 92 static int uhci_pci_global_suspend_mode_is_broken(struct uhci_hcd *uhci) in uhci_pci_global_suspend_mode_is_broken() 116 struct uhci_hcd *uhci = hcd_to_uhci(hcd); in uhci_pci_init() 174 struct uhci_hcd *uhci = hcd_to_uhci(hcd); in uhci_pci_suspend() 213 struct uhci_hcd *uhci = hcd_to_uhci(hcd); in uhci_pci_resume() 260 .hcd_priv_size = sizeof(struct uhci_hcd),
|
A D | uhci-q.c | 29 static void uhci_set_next_interrupt(struct uhci_hcd *uhci) in uhci_set_next_interrupt() 47 static void uhci_fsbr_on(struct uhci_hcd *uhci) in uhci_fsbr_on() 60 static void uhci_fsbr_off(struct uhci_hcd *uhci) in uhci_fsbr_off() 94 struct uhci_hcd *uhci = from_timer(uhci, t, fsbr_timer); in uhci_fsbr_timeout() 106 static struct uhci_td *uhci_alloc_td(struct uhci_hcd *uhci) in uhci_alloc_td() 245 static struct uhci_qh *uhci_alloc_qh(struct uhci_hcd *uhci, in uhci_alloc_qh() 740 static void uhci_free_urb_priv(struct uhci_hcd *uhci, in uhci_free_urb_priv() 1122 static int uhci_fixup_short_transfer(struct uhci_hcd *uhci, in uhci_fixup_short_transfer() 1412 struct uhci_hcd *uhci = hcd_to_uhci(hcd); in uhci_urb_enqueue() 1483 struct uhci_hcd *uhci = hcd_to_uhci(hcd); in uhci_urb_dequeue() [all …]
|
A D | uhci-hub.c | 44 static int any_ports_active(struct uhci_hcd *uhci) in any_ports_active() 57 static inline int get_hub_status_data(struct uhci_hcd *uhci, char *buf) in get_hub_status_data() 96 static void uhci_finish_suspend(struct uhci_hcd *uhci, int port, in uhci_finish_suspend() 125 static void wait_for_HP(struct uhci_hcd *uhci, unsigned long port_addr) in wait_for_HP() 137 static void uhci_check_ports(struct uhci_hcd *uhci) in uhci_check_ports() 188 struct uhci_hcd *uhci = hcd_to_uhci(hcd); in uhci_hub_status_data() 246 struct uhci_hcd *uhci = hcd_to_uhci(hcd); in uhci_hub_control()
|
A D | uhci-platform.c | 17 struct uhci_hcd *uhci = hcd_to_uhci(hcd); in uhci_platform_init() 40 .hcd_priv_size = sizeof(struct uhci_hcd), 71 struct uhci_hcd *uhci; in uhci_hcd_platform_probe() 158 struct uhci_hcd *uhci = hcd_to_uhci(hcd); in uhci_hcd_platform_remove()
|
A D | uhci-debug.c | 43 static int uhci_show_td(struct uhci_hcd *uhci, struct uhci_td *td, char *buf, in uhci_show_td() 100 static int uhci_show_urbp(struct uhci_hcd *uhci, struct urb_priv *urbp, in uhci_show_urbp() 165 static int uhci_show_qh(struct uhci_hcd *uhci, in uhci_show_qh() 279 static int uhci_show_root_hub_state(struct uhci_hcd *uhci, char *buf) in uhci_show_root_hub_state() 305 static int uhci_show_status(struct uhci_hcd *uhci, char *buf, int len) in uhci_show_status() 374 static int uhci_sprint_schedule(struct uhci_hcd *uhci, char *buf, int len) in uhci_sprint_schedule() 560 struct uhci_hcd *uhci = inode->i_private; in uhci_debug_open() 625 static inline int uhci_show_qh(struct uhci_hcd *uhci, in uhci_show_qh() 631 static inline int uhci_sprint_schedule(struct uhci_hcd *uhci, in uhci_sprint_schedule()
|
A D | uhci-grlib.c | 28 struct uhci_hcd *uhci = hcd_to_uhci(hcd); in uhci_grlib_init() 62 .hcd_priv_size = sizeof(struct uhci_hcd), 94 struct uhci_hcd *uhci = NULL; in uhci_hcd_grlib_probe()
|
/linux-6.3-rc2/Documentation/input/ |
A D | input.rst | 44 uhci_hcd or ohci_hcd or ehci_hcd
|
/linux-6.3-rc2/Documentation/admin-guide/ |
A D | sysfs-rules.rst | 74 - driver (``tg3``, ``ata_piix``, ``uhci_hcd``)
|
/linux-6.3-rc2/Documentation/trace/ |
A D | ftrace.rst | 3465 sshd-1995 [001] d.h1 138.733278: irq_handler_entry: irq=21 name=uhci_hcd:usb4
|
Completed in 18 milliseconds